Firemonkey-在TWebBrowser中获取单击的超链接

时间:2018-10-18 20:47:41

标签: delphi firemonkey delphi-10.2-tokyo

我在我的表单上有一个带有TWebBrowser和TEdit的浏览器应用程序。当我在TEdit中输入URL时,它将在页面上显示内容。现在,如果单击页面上的某些链接,则应用程序应加载新页面并将TEdit更新为新的URL(类似于任何浏览器)。我尝试使用TWebBrowser.URL属性,但它也拦截了所有脚本调用,例如,例如。如果我在浏览器中打开gmail并单击登录链接,则IE显示正确的链接(https://accounts.google.com/signin/v2/identifier?continue=https%3A%2F%2Fmail.google.com%2Fmail%2F&service=mail&sacu=1&rip=1&flowName=GlifWebSignIn&flowEntry=ServiceLogin),但firemonkey应用程序显示了一些不同的URL。有什么方法可以在Firemonkey中获得这些URL?

0 个答案:

没有答案